Understanding Your Kindle Scribe Battery
The Kindle Scribe 16GB uses a rechargeable lithium-ion battery designed to last for several years with proper care. Over time, battery capacity diminishes, leading to shorter usage periods between charges. Recognizing signs of battery degradation is crucial for timely replacement.
Signs Your Battery Needs Replacement
- Your device drains quickly even after a full charge.
- It takes longer to charge than usual.
- The device unexpectedly turns off or restarts.
- Battery percentage drops rapidly without usage.
- Physical swelling or damage to the device.
How to Replace the Battery
Replacing the battery in your Kindle Scribe requires careful handling. Follow these steps to ensure safety and proper installation:
- Power off your device and disconnect it from any power source.
- Use appropriate tools to open the back cover, typically a plastic pry tool or small screwdriver.
- Locate the battery connector and gently disconnect it.
- Remove the old battery carefully, noting its placement.
- Insert the new battery, ensuring it is secured and properly connected.
- Reassemble the device in reverse order, making sure all screws are tightened.
Battery Care Tips for Longevity
Proper care extends your battery’s lifespan. Implement these best practices:
- Avoid letting the battery fully discharge regularly; keep it above 20% when possible.
- Charge your Kindle Scribe with a compatible charger and avoid overcharging.
- Keep your device in a cool, dry environment to prevent overheating.
- Use the device regularly to maintain battery health.
- Update your device’s firmware to optimize battery performance.
Additional Tips for Maintaining Your Kindle Scribe
Beyond battery care, maintaining your Kindle Scribe enhances its overall lifespan:
- Regularly clean the screen with a soft, lint-free cloth.
- Avoid exposing the device to extreme temperatures.
- Disable unnecessary features like Wi-Fi when not in use to conserve power.
- Periodically restart the device to clear memory and improve performance.
